Water Aerobics
Water Aerobics
Make a splash with water exercise! This is the perfect exercise for people just starting a routine, or those that want to diversify their workouts! Water aerobics offers a great cardiovascular workout that will tone the entire body. The buoyancy of the water also helps protect the joints and is perfect for participants at all levels.

The Deep
This class uses interval training alternating periods of higher and lower intensity exercise. Pacing is increased until an aerobic threshold is reached, followed by a decrease in pace returning to regular target heart rate zone. Deep water is a non-impact exercise class using power for perfect body conditioning for the more athletic water participant.
